oscommerce已经过时了吗?

时间:2010-07-23 07:24:46

标签: php e-commerce oscommerce

OSCommerce过时了吗?

我最近开始为一家使用它的网络开发公司工作,我注意到代码库非常混乱,并且有很多旧的PHP代码。习惯了像cakePHP或drupal这样的好东西,我对它并没有太深刻的印象。

是否值得再使用? 是否有一个体面的OSC端口更新并且易于将现有商店转移到?奖励积分,如果它的插件系统不是黑客节目。

现在我正在寻找Zen-cart,Ubercart和Magento作为替代品。你会推荐别的吗?

THANKYOU

6 个答案:

答案 0 :(得分:6)

  

OSCommerce过时了吗?

这取决于你如何定义过时的。如果您使用的是v1.0,那么是的。但是osCommerce仍然在积极维护和发展。目前的开发版本是osCommerce 3.0 Alpha 5.

  

我最近开始为一家使用它的网络开发公司工作,我注意到代码库非常混乱,并且有很多旧的PHP代码。习惯了像cakePHP或drupal这样的好东西,我对它并没有太深刻的印象。

我相信你可以找到更漂亮的架构。我简要地查看了源代码,并且可以确认现在有许多被认为是代码味道的东西,比如很多已定义的常量,全局关键字等等。与现在的标准相比,代码库是老式的,但这就是多年来不断发展的长期运行系统的方式。老式并不一定意味着过时。

  

是否值得再使用?是否有一个体面的OSC端口更新并且易于将现有商店转移到?奖励积分,如果它的插件系统不是黑客节目。

osCommerce是一款成熟的产品。就像一开始说的那样,它是积极维护的。您不应该仅仅根据代码库来确定应用程序的价值。 Wordpress将毫无价值。 CakePHP也不是它的代码库。您将安装ocCommerce的客户端很少对代码库感兴趣,而是系统能否满足他或她对商店系统的要求。

  

现在我正在寻找Zen-cart,Ubercart和Magento作为替代品。你会推荐别的吗?

几年前还有来自osCommerce的xtCommerce。但这并不意味着推荐。我发现很难在没有任何要求的情况下从大量系统推荐商店系统。

旁注:如果您想收集有关osCommerce的软件指标,请转到phpqatools.org并运行一些工具,收集统计数据并将其与其他商店系统进行比较。

答案 1 :(得分:3)

简答:是的

我无法告诉你有关版本3(路线图中的alpha项目)的任何信息,但如果你使用的是2.x,那么与其他购物解决方案(如magento(我喜欢称之为')相比,你在2006年基本上停滞不前女主角'因为一切都有价格。)

答案 2 :(得分:1)

OSCommerce比西蒙斯更老......而且SIMMONS已经老了!

避免像瘟疫一样。

Magento和Cube Cart很不错。如果您正在寻找并从蛋糕或drupal升级,那么会选择Symfony。 : - )

答案 3 :(得分:1)

osCommerce 2.x.x有点过时,原因如下:

  1. 没有MVC概念。这使得维护变得非常困难,当一个错误得到修复时,另一个错误可能会出现。

  2. 建筑学从2001年开始。随着概念架构的进步变得非常重要。所以没有使用更新的设计概念的好处。

  3. 安全问题:许多插件由于未更新而无法保护。 osCommerce的最新版本是安全的。

答案 4 :(得分:0)

尚未,您可以使用第3版.Oscommerce有很好的社区而不是其他人。最重要的事情Oscommerce是完整的GUI许可证,拥有庞大的代码库。像其他电子商务一样有很多限制和限制,而且大多数是付费的。

这就是为什么我们不能说oscommerce现在已经过时,但将来我们会说任何事情,

答案 5 :(得分:0)

osCommerce 2.x基于2001 - 2002年的技术(交换项目)。多年来,他们已经添加了som补丁和油漆,使其成为立足点。所以是的,它已经过时了。一直都是。

最后一个版本2.3.1是迄今为止最大的重写(不包括3.0)。我想说还有一些工作要做。

osCommerce 3.0只是一个框架。它没有添加产品或类别的功能。它只适用于想要为下一代osCommerce做贡献的开发人员。